About emergency and important number magnets

Real estate agents have used these for decades, and the logic still holds: if you don't want to buy calendar magnets every year, an important numbers magnet builds brand awareness in a farm area and stays on local fridges for years rather than months.

Councils, property managers, trades and community groups order them for the same reason — the content is a genuine public service, so nobody throws it out.

Emergency and important number magnets questions

What is an emergency number fridge magnet?
An emergency number magnet lists key contacts — 000, poisons information, local services or your own after-hours line — in a fixed spot on the fridge. They start from 25 cents each with a 500 unit minimum.
Why do real estate agents use important number magnets?
Because they last. Unlike a calendar that expires each December, an important numbers magnet stays useful for years, so an agent builds brand awareness in a farm area without reprinting annually.
Can I combine emergency numbers with my business details?
Yes. Listing standard emergency contacts alongside your logo, phone number and after-hours line is the most common configuration, and it pairs a public service with ongoing brand exposure.
What size suits an emergency numbers magnet?
DL (210 × 97mm) suits a standard number panel with branding. A5 (148 × 210mm) gives legible room for a longer list of local contacts.
